Coastal Altimetry (Hardcover, Edition.): Stefano Vignudelli, Andrey G. Kostianoy, Paolo Cipollini, Jerome Benveniste Coastal Altimetry (Hardcover, Edition.)
Stefano Vignudelli, Andrey G. Kostianoy, Paolo Cipollini, Jerome Benveniste
R6,422 Discovery Miles 64 220 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

The book describes experience in application of coastal altimetry to different parts of the World Ocean. It presents the principal problems related to the altimetry derived products in coastal regions of the ocean and ways of their improvement. This publication is based on numerous satellite and observational data collected and analyzed by the authors of the various chapters in the framework of a set of international projects, performed in UK, France, Italy, Denmark, Russia, USA, Mexico and India. The book will contribute both to the ongoing International Altimeter Service effort and to the building of a sustained coastal observing system in the perspective of GMES (Global Monitoring for Environment and Security) and GEOSS (Global Earth Observation System of Systems) initiatives. This book is aimed at specialists concerned with research in the various fields of satellite altimetry, remote sensing, and coastal physical oceanography. The book will be also interesting for lecturers, students and post-graduate students.

Geohazards and Risks Studied from Earth Observations (Paperback, 1st ed. 2022): Teodolina Lopez, Anny Cazenave, Mioara Mandea,... Geohazards and Risks Studied from Earth Observations (Paperback, 1st ed. 2022)
Teodolina Lopez, Anny Cazenave, Mioara Mandea, Jerome Benveniste
R2,085 Discovery Miles 20 850 Ships in 12 - 19 working days

The Sentinel missions of the COPERNICUS Programme of the European Union, as well as other Earth Observation missions, provide new opportunities for systematic monitoring of natural and man-made hazards and disasters that can highly impact human societies.The contributions collected in this book address a broad range of geohazards observable from space, including earthquakes, volcanic hazards, extreme events (e.g. storm surges, floods and droughts), fires, pollution, tipping points in physical and biological systems, etc.. They provide information on how space observations can improve our understanding of the driving mechanisms at the origin of such geohazards, and of their mutual interactions. Focus is given on the expected added-value information obtained by combining different types of space-based and in situ observations as well as model results. The chapters "Space-Based Earth Observations for Disaster Risk Management", "Earth Observation for the Assessment of Earthquake Hazard, Risk and Disaster Management", "Earth Observation for Crustal Tectonics and Earthquake Hazards", "Earth Observations for Monitoring Marine Coastal Hazards and Their Drivers", "Air Pollution and Sea Pollution Seen from Space" are available open access under a Creative Commons Attribution 4.0 International License via link.springer.com.
